Upgraded Stryker variant debuts on NATO’s east flank
A Stryker squadron based in Vilseck, Germany, fired live ammunition from newly upgraded Stryker vehicles for the first time in Europe this week, Stars and Stripes reported.
The 3rd Squadron, 2nd Cavalry Regiment conducted the gunnery exercise August 20 at the Grafenwoehr Training Area, using the new ICVVA1-30mm variant of the Stryker Double-V Hull Infantry Carrier Vehicle.
The unit is the first outside the United States to receive the upgraded vehicles, according to Stars and Stripes. Twenty of the new Strykers began arriving in February and will be fielded across the rest of the regiment, Capt. Alexander Stamatiou, commander of the squadron’s Killer Troop, told the outlet.
The vehicles carry a 30 mm semiautomatic cannon in addition to M240 machine guns. Some are also equipped with self-contained 120 mm mortars, .50-caliber machine guns and mounted Javelin anti-tank launchers, Stamatiou said.
“Versus a peer adversary, for an infantry carrier vehicle these are unmatched,” Stamatiou said.
The Army selected Oshkosh Defense in June 2021 to integrate the 30 mm Medium Caliber Weapon System onto the Stryker ICVVA1, under a six-year requirements contract with partners Pratt Miller Defense and Rafael Advanced Defense Systems worth up to $942.9 million. The weapon system is based on Rafael’s SAMSON turret family. The Army has since ordered 269 upgraded vehicles for $356 million to outfit three Stryker Brigade Combat Teams, along with additional units for testing and logistics development. Oshkosh delivered the first upgraded vehicle to the Army’s Aberdeen Test Center in August 2022, and fielding began in 2023 with the 1-2 Stryker Brigade Combat Team at Joint Base Lewis-McChord in Washington state.
The new variant also gives infantry squad leaders independent sights that let them designate targets for the vehicle’s gunner, Spc. Spencer Riley told Stars and Stripes.
“There’s actually a feature where I can flip a switch and my gun will automatically move to what he’s looking at,” Riley said. “And then I can engage straight from there.”
Soldiers said the upgraded vehicle also lets crews reload weapons and perform maintenance from inside the vehicle rather than climbing outside it. Sgt. Oliver Estela demonstrated that capability during the exercise when a round jammed in his machine gun. Estela climbed into the vehicle’s unmanned turret, cleared the jam and resumed firing within minutes.
“It’s more convenient,” Estela said, calling the new Stryker variant “way more capable than our older platforms.”
The vehicles also feature improved engines, optics, communications and targeting systems compared with earlier Stryker models, Stamatiou said.
Separately, the Army has been testing vehicle-mounted and wearable counter-drone systems through an initiative called Project Flytrap, aimed at detecting, tracking and jamming hostile drones. Personnel transport vehicles have increasingly come under attack from first-person-view and commercial drones during the war between Russia and Ukraine.
